What is a Pre Carbon Filter?
A pre carbon filter is placed before the RO membrane in a water purifier. It contains activated carbon granules or blocks that absorb chlorine, pesticides, chemicals, and organic impurities. This process ensures that only cleaner water passes through to the RO membrane, protecting it from damage.
How Does a Pre Carbon Filter Work?
The working mechanism is based on adsorption. The activated carbon in the filter attracts and holds contaminants like chlorine, volatile organic compounds (VOCs), and other harmful chemicals, preventing them from reaching the sensitive RO membrane.
Benefits of a Pre Carbon Filter
Protects RO Membrane: Prevents damage caused by chlorine and chemicals.
Improves Water Taste: Removes odors and enhances the freshness of water.
Increases Purifier Lifespan: Reduces strain on the RO system.
Affordable Maintenance: Easy to replace and cost-effective.
Pre Carbon Filter Price in India
Domestic RO Pre Carbon Filters: ₹300 – ₹800
Inline Pre Carbon Filters: ₹250 – ₹700
Commercial Pre Carbon Filters: ₹2,000 – ₹5,000 depending on capacity

Q1. Why is a pre carbon filter necessary in an RO system?
It removes chlorine and chemicals that can damage the RO membrane.
Q2. How often should I replace a pre carbon filter?
Every 6–12 months, depending on water quality and usage.
Q3. Does a pre carbon filter improve water taste?
Yes, it removes odors and enhances taste by filtering out chlorine.
